Aftermarket automotive parts have become increasingly popular due to their affordability and availability. However, not all aftermarket parts are created equal. Knowing how to identify quality components is essential for maintaining your vehicle's performance.
Start by researching the brand of the aftermarket part. Look for manufacturers with a good reputation in the industry. Reading customer reviews and seeking recommendations can provide insights into the quality of their products.
Quality aftermarket parts should come with certifications that indicate they meet industry standards. Look for certifications such as ISO or DOT approval to ensure you're investing in reliable components.
A reputable aftermarket manufacturer will often provide a warranty on their parts. This warranty not only reflects their confidence in the product but also offers protection for the consumer in case of defects or failures.
Ensure that the aftermarket part is compatible with your vehicle. Check specifications and user manuals to confirm proper fitment. Poorly fitting parts can lead to performance issues and even damage to your vehicle.
Identifying quality aftermarket automotive parts requires careful consideration and research. By following these guidelines, vehicle owners can make informed choices that enhance performance and longevity.
